Members of Maseru local councils express their concerns about Ministry of Local Government and Chief
26 October 2018 | 00:01

Members of different local councils in Maseru district met in Maseru yesterday, to discuss their concerns about the Ministry of Local Government and Chieftainship.

During the meeting a member of Manonyane Local Council in Roma, who is also a chairman of the Maseru local council Mr Mohoalohoaloo Jane, said starting from 1997 up until now, issues pertaining to local councils in Lesotho have been a mess, because of ministers who led Ministry of Local Government and Chieftainship.

Mr Jane said those ministers humiliated and discredited local councilors, while officials in that ministry centralized public services to the ministry, instead of decentralizing them to local councils.

Mr Jane also said they are shocked and amazed by the Minister of Local Government and Chieftainship, who over the radios indicates that the government pays local councilors who are doing nothing, a total of over M60m in a year.

He said they are also shocked to hear the minister announcing that the decentralization process of public services to local councils will be done in 2022, while in August this year Prime Minister Dr Motsoahae Thomas Thabane allowed ministers to decentralize services to local councils within six months starting from August 2018.
